The RGB color code for color number #B6BEE4 is RGB(182, 190, 228). In the RGB color model, #B6BEE4 has a red value of 182, a green value of 190, and a blue value of 228.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 20.2%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 10.6%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 229.6° (degrees), 46.0 % saturation, and 80.4 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#B6BEE4 has a hue of 229.6° (degrees), 20.2 % saturation and 89.4 % brightness/value.
Color B6BEE4 is cool or warm?
Color B6BEE4 is a cool color.
What is the LRV of B6BEE4?
Color code B6BEE4 has an LRV of nearly 52.
By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
